Scholarships are awarded to students who have performed excellently well in their academics. Sri Krishnadevaraya University scholarships are also offered to needy and meritorious students. The students of the university are also encouraged to apply for various state and national scholarships.
Sri Krishnadevaraya University scholarships are also offered in the form of fee concession to its students. The state-level scholarship that students belonging to Andhra Pradesh can apply for is the Post Matric Scholarship. The scholarship scheme is available to all the students belonging to SC, ST, BC, EBC (other than Kapu), Kapu, Minority, Differently-abled categories on a saturation basis. The eligibility criteria and the amount of Sri Krishnadevaraya University scholarships is given in the table below:
Name of the Scholarship | Eligibility Criteria | Amount |
Post Matric Scholarship | Candidates must pursue polytechnic, ITI or degree courses from any government/aided/private colleges, affiliated to the State Universities/ Boards. 75% attendance in aggregate. The annual income of the family must be less than or equal Rs 2.50 lakhs. The total land holding of the family must be less than 10 acres of wet or 25 acres of dry or 25 acres of both dry and wet together. No member of the family of the candidate must be a government employee/pensioner. | The scheme offers Rs 20,000 per person per year to every eligible student for food and hostel expenses. |
The national level scholarship schemes that students can apply for are- Post Matric Scholarship which is offered by the Ministry of Minority Affairs, Govt. of India and Central Sector Scheme of Scholarship for College and University students offered by Ministry of Human Resource Development, Department of Higher Education. The details of all the scholarships are given in the table below.
Name of the Scholarship | Scholarship Provided By | Eligibility Criteria |
Post Matric Scholarship | Ministry of Minority Affair, Govt. of India | Applicants must be the student of notified minority community (Jain, Buddhist, Sikh, Parsee, Christian and Muslim). Applicants must be studying in India in a government or recognised private institution. The course being pursued should be a minimum of 1 year. The applicant should have at least 50% in the last class/board examination. The parental income should not exceed 2 lakhs per annum for Post Matric Scholarship. |
Central Sector Scheme of Scholarship for College and University students | Ministry of Human Resource Development, Department of Higher Education | Applicants who are above 80th percentile of successful candidates in the relevant stream from the respective Board of Examination in Class XII of 10+2 pattern or equivalent and pursuing regular courses. Students should not be availing the benefit of any other scholarship scheme including State run scholarship schemes/Fee waiver and reimbursement scheme. Students should not be pursuing Diploma courses. |
